    Default make up primers

    do you use makeup primers on your skin to ensure that your makeup stays on all day?

    i do! and it actually depends on what my makeup is for the day. if its going to be light, and im using my bare escentuals, i use the primer that comes with their get started kit. it really makes my skin very soft!

    but if i'm going out to a party, and will most likely pose for a lot of pictures, i use smashbox's photo finish primer.

    how about you?

    I use primers as well. Initially, I didn't want to use it because I thought it would clog my pores, but the reverse is actually the truth. Instead of clogging pores, primers help prevent pores from being clogged. It acts like a silicone to fill up open pores and make skin smoother all over.

    I also love how primers can make my makeup last longer as it reduces the secretion of oil. I use Smashbox and a cheaper one from The Face Shop (a Korean chain), both of which work well.

    I heard that some apply primers after putting on makeup. Has anyone tried this?

    like you said, primers act as a silicon shield to keep makeup from clogging your pores. if you apply primer AFTER you apply makeup, it'll trap the makeup against your pores.

    my friend tried this and it made her break out like crazy. ewww.
